How does Bitcoin’s role in financial crises influence investor sentiment? During financial crises, Bitcoin is seen as a hedge against economic instability. In times of banking failures or currency devaluation, Bitcoin adoption spikes. However, short-term panic may cause price dips before long-term appreciation as trust in traditional systems declines.

How Does Crypto Arbitrage Trading Work? Crypto arbitrage involves buying an asset on one exchange at a lower price and selling it on another at a higher price. Traders exploit price discrepancies across platforms like Binance and Coinbase. Arbitrage strategies include cross-exchange, triangular, and flash loan arbitrage. While it offers low-risk profits, challenges include transaction fees, withdrawal delays, and regulatory restrictions. Automated bots enhance efficiency in arbitrage trading.
